Written Answers. - Dental Treatment.

Austin Currie

Question:

206 Mr. Currie asked the Minister for Health the present position of a person (details supplied) in County Dublin who was informed on 26 May 1989 by the Dublin Dental Hospital that she would be examined with a view to the formulation of a treatment plan but has heard nothing since; whether this person's name is on a waiting list for treatment; if so, her number on the waiting list; and if he will make a statement on the matter.

The person concerned was referred by her local dental clinic to the Dublin Dental Hospital for an assessment of her orthodontic condition. She will be called in the near future. If her assessment shows that her condition is suitable for treatment in the hospital her name will be added to the waiting list for treatment.
